   Ah, I see. Now, that actually works as well with the functions (something we 
probably need to document better):
   
   ```
   In [2]: pc.is_nan(pc.field("a"))
   Out[2]: <pyarrow.compute.Expression is_nan(a)>
   ```
   But given that we have a method on the expression for is_null, we could 
maybe do that for is_nan as well (although is_nan is specific to one data type, 
while is_null is generic).
